Understanding RAM and its Importance in Laptops
RAM, or Random Access Memory, is a crucial component of any computer system, including laptops. It acts as temporary storage for data that the processor needs to access quickly. Think of RAM as your desk space: the more space you have, the more documents you can keep readily available. When your laptop runs out of RAM, it has to resort to using the hard drive or solid-state drive as virtual memory, which is significantly slower and can lead to noticeable performance slowdowns.
But why thirty-two gigabytes? This generous amount of RAM provides a considerable performance boost, especially for users who engage in demanding tasks. Video editors, for instance, can work with large video files and complex timelines without experiencing lag or crashes. Software developers can run multiple virtual machines and development environments simultaneously. Gamers can enjoy smoother gameplay with higher frame rates and reduced loading times. Those who routinely work with large datasets, such as scientists, researchers, and data analysts, will also find thirty-two gigabytes of RAM invaluable. It enables seamless manipulation and analysis of data without the bottlenecks caused by insufficient memory.
However, it’s important to be honest about whether you genuinely need thirty-two gigabytes of RAM. If you primarily use your laptop for basic tasks like browsing the web, checking email, and writing documents, you might be perfectly happy with eight gigabytes or sixteen gigabytes of RAM. These smaller amounts are more than sufficient for everyday use and will save you money in the long run. Consider your typical usage patterns and the types of applications you run most frequently before deciding on thirty-two gigabytes of RAM.
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Laptop with Generous Memory
When shopping for laptop deals with thirty-two gigabytes of RAM, it’s essential to consider factors beyond just the memory capacity. The laptop’s overall performance depends on a combination of components working together harmoniously.
First and foremost, the processor, or CPU, is crucial. A powerful processor, such as an Intel Core i-seven or an AMD Ryzen seven, is necessary to take full advantage of the thirty-two gigabytes of RAM. A weak processor will bottleneck the system, preventing you from experiencing the full potential of the memory.
Storage is another critical consideration. Opting for a solid-state drive, or SSD, is highly recommended. SSDs are significantly faster than traditional hard disk drives, or HDDs, resulting in quicker boot times, faster application loading, and overall snappier performance. A large SSD will provide ample space for your operating system, applications, and data files.
If you’re a gamer or someone who works with graphics-intensive applications, a dedicated graphics card, or GPU, is essential. A powerful GPU will handle the processing of visual data, freeing up the CPU and RAM for other tasks. Look for laptops with NVIDIA GeForce RTX or AMD Radeon RX graphics cards for the best gaming and content creation experiences.
The display is also an important factor, especially for content creators and gamers. Consider the resolution, refresh rate, and color accuracy of the display. A higher resolution display will provide sharper images, while a higher refresh rate will result in smoother motion. Accurate color representation is crucial for tasks like photo and video editing.
Finally, pay attention to the available ports on the laptop. Make sure it has enough USB-C, Thunderbolt, HDMI, and other ports to accommodate your peripherals and accessories.
Beyond performance, consider the form factor and portability of the laptop. Do you need a lightweight and ultraportable machine that you can easily carry around? Or are you willing to sacrifice portability for a larger screen and more powerful components? Think about build quality and durability as well. A well-built laptop will withstand the rigors of daily use and last longer. The operating system, whether Windows or macOS, depends on personal preference and software compatibility. Battery life is another important factor, as thirty-two gigabytes of RAM can consume more power.

Optimizing Laptop Performance
Once you have your new laptop with thirty-two gigabytes of RAM, there are several things you can do to optimize its performance. First, keep your operating system and drivers up to date. Software updates often include performance improvements and bug fixes. Close unnecessary programs to avoid running too many background processes.
If you have a solid-state drive, it is important to maintain it, but modern SSDs largely handle this automatically. Use the Task Manager (Windows) or Activity Monitor (macOS) to track RAM usage and identify resource-intensive applications. Finally, make sure virtual memory or the page file is enabled and configured correctly, especially if your solid-state drive has plenty of space.
